Third Annual WMU Research and Creative Activities Poster Day
Reem El Asaleh, PhD Student, and Hemant Bohra, MS student were chosen by the PCI Department to represent the department at the Celebration of Research and Creative Activities Poster Day that was held on Friday, April 10th in the Fetzer Center.

Reem and Hemant were part of the top 15 graduate students to win an award to recognize the outstanding graduate student posters/displays. Both PCI graduate students were awarded with $200 cash each.
